Alvor is a Portuguese town and parish in the municipality of Portimão, with an area of 15.25 km² and 6,154 inhabitants (2011). Its population density is 403.5 inhabitants km².
Land of maritime and fishing tradition, of deep religious beliefs, marked by the Mother Church, from which its main portico of great decorative richness stands out, it is known for its beaches and its fishing village near the mouth of the river.
It has always been subject to the misfortunes of toil and misfortunes of the sea. Today, in parallel with artisanal fishing, catering, commerce and tourism are the main economic activities.
Although it is customary to hear visitors or outsiders call the village "O Alvor", the designation "O Alvor" refers to the river of the same name. For someone to refer to Alvor, they simply must indicate Alvor or village of Alvor.
Although its main industry is tourism, its economic activities are also agriculture, hotels, restaurants, tourism, commerce, construction and fishing.
